On Sun, Oct 15, 2006 at 11:40:31AM +0200, pHilipp Zabel wrote:
> On 10/13/06, Russell King <rmk+lkml@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x> wrote:
> >The problem is likely that the boot is continuing in parallel with
> >detecting the card, because the card detection is running in its own
> >separate thread. Meanwhile, the init thread is trying to read from
> >the as-yet missing root device and erroring out.
>
> Thanks, I can work around this by using the rootdelay kernel parameter.
> So does that mean this is the expected behavior, or should I do anything
> in the bootup sequence to make the init process wait for mmc detection?

That's up to Pierre now. I originally ensured that the initial boot
time card detection was synchronous with the boot to avoid unexpected
problems like this.
